What was done

Narrative review synthesizing literature on how peripheral insulin resistance and chronic inflammation interact with blood-brain barrier integrity, glial activation, and Alzheimer's disease pathology.

What was found

The abstract provides no quantitative data or specific numerical findings. It summarizes proposed pathways where peripheral metabolic dysfunction promotes oxidative stress, cytokine release, blood-brain barrier disruption, glial activation, and accelerated amyloid-beta and tau pathology.

Why it matters

Summarizes the conceptual and mechanistic links between peripheral metabolic disorders like type 2 diabetes and neurodegenerative processes in Alzheimer's disease.

Limits

Narrative review with no original empirical data, quantitative synthesis, or explicit methodology described in the abstract.
